Community Tasting Notes 1

  • cuffthis Likes this wine: 86 points

    February 27, 2014 - Pale straw in color and slightly cloudy, this wine showed white flowers, slate and dried citrus on the nose. The mouth feel was full bodied with varietally correct spicy and peppery elements. The finish was moderate with nice acidity, integrating the 13% abv with ease.

    Available for $9.99US for a 1.0L bottle, this is an excellent qpr and a great introduction to Austria's most popular wine varietal. Perfect as an aperitif, it has enough substance to keep both casual and informed wine drinkers happy.
